In this project, i’ll show you how to build an arduino & bluetooth controlled robotic arm using android phone. this robotic arm can be operated in either manual mode or can be programmable to be operated in fully automatic mode. 🔍 project overview this project uses an arduino uno, an hc 05 bluetooth module, and a custom android smartphone app to control a 6 dof robotic arm wirelessly. each servo motor is controlled individually through sliders in the mobile app. the system also supports saving multiple movement positions and replaying them automatically in sequence.
